How to resolve a system of linear equations
In this question we find a system of two linear equations with two variables, which means the possibility of one solution only.
There are several methods to resolve this system and we have chose the determinant method which offers a visual-like and efficient method. Now we proceed to present the procedure:
Determinant of the matrix of dependent coefficients
[tex]D = \left[\begin{array}{cc}3&6\\1&2\end{array}\right][/tex]
D = 3 · 2 - 1 · 6
D = 0
For the determinant of dependent coefficients is equal to 0, it means that one equation of the system is a multiple of the other and therefore the system of linear equations is inconsistent and solutions do not exists.
